    What Moves the Needle? Ranking Drivers Revealed

    Forget superficial metrics. Here''s what truly impacts manufacturer rankings:

    • Response time to grid fluctuations: Top systems achieve < 50ms adjustments
    • Thermal management efficiency: Leaders maintain ±1.5°C cell temperature variance
    • Cycling stability: 8,000+ deep cycles at 90% capacity retention
    Technology Round-Trip Efficiency Installation Cost (USD/kWh)
    Lithium-Ion BESS 92-95% 280-350
    Flow Batteries 75-80% 400-600

    FAQs: Quick Answers for Decision Makers

    What''s more important – cell chemistry or system integration?

    While battery tech matters, 63% of project failures stem from poor integration. Prioritize manufacturers with proven balance-of-plant expertise.

    How do certifications impact manufacturer selection?

    Mandatory certifications include IEC 62619 for safety and ISO 14001 for environmental management. Many utilities now require additional cyber protection standards like NERC CIP.
